Le Jardin - Block of the Month























I just completed another Bunny Hill Design, " Le Jardin." Well, I haven't actually completed it. I've made the blocks and photograghed them separately so it will give you a visual if you would like to do the block of the month. I used fabric from Moda, Garden Party mostly instead of the fabric shown on the pattern. I wanted it to be "springy" and something that would fit into most home decor.
Here is how it works. The first month's block will be $25.00. Blocks 2-9 will be $15.00 each month. The borders and binding will be $35.00. At the beginning of each month I will send you the fabric, pattern and embellishments needed for that month's block. The postage is $2.50 each month with the border and binding postage being $7.00. I will bill your credit card each month unless you would like to make other arrangements. Work on it together with friends or on your own. It's great fun to get something in the mail each month.

The Sebago Bag

If you want to make a nice and easy tote, this is it. All it takes is one yard of prequilted fabric and 1/4 yd for trim. It's finished on the inside as well so it's reversible. I'm having trouble finding prequilted fabric so I think I may try to make my own. If I can machine quilt a lap quilt I can certainly quilt a yardof fabric.
